Authentic Expressions

Kid D is someone who has been around in the industry, perfecting his music, for many years now and has now released his new album – Authentic Expressions, which features artists like Kyze, Dotty, Ghetts , Tigz and many more.

The album will be out on his own label, ‘2 Easy Records’, which has received huge popularity across the the world. The album is a perfect expression of his artistic talent and is set to mesmerize the huge fans bases, namely in USA, Japan, Canada, Jamaica and the UK.

‘Own Dynamics’ is the album intro and is a great vibe, with some melodic piano works and soulful bass. ‘Illusion’ feat. Ghetts has a great thumping vibe to it with some great rhymes, and ‘Roll The Dice’ sounds much more thrilling and mysterious; a really great sounding instrumental.

The lead single of the album, ‘Wavin’ feat. Max Rock, is a great display of truly authentic hip-hop, while ‘What I Do For You’ sounds somewhere between pop and hip-hop, once again displaying a very groovy, slow tempo. ‘Silent Pain’ is very unique, sounding soothing with chimes and rocking with some great rap.

‘Uplift’ truly lift up the mood of the album and is perfectly placed in it too. The track featuring Kyze, ‘Slow Down’, offers a crisp vibe of percussive fun and catchy vocals. ‘My Essence’ is very powerful and futuristic in its texture, while ‘Spray Off’ feat. Tigzis once again a heavy hitting song on the mind and the emotions too, with its violin bits.

‘Jet Pack’ is a fast-paced track which has some great work done in the form of the unique sounding loops and the last track, feat. Max Rock, ‘Made It’ offers a simply soothing vibe, coupled with percussion at the right time and the crisp lyrical work- truly a great end to the pack.

Growing up in South East London, he drew from his surroundings to create a sonic rendition of his experiences in of the world’s creative capitals. His profound vision and versatile styles lead him to the production of singles along with the likes of Wiley, Skepta, Ghetts and Devlin. Although, his original aim was always to elevate the grime scene with his unique nature of production.
